DRDO’s Defense Technology and Test Centre (DTTC), Lucknow conducted a conclave at Amausi Campus on September 06, 2025 to apprise and collaborate with MSMEs & start-ups for Defense R&D and production with an aim to further develop the Uttar Pradesh Defense Industrial Corridor. More than 100 participants from various MSMEs, Start-Ups and Laghu Udhyog Bharti deliberated upon aspects of Skill Development, Funding for R&D, Technical Consultancy and Technology Development & Transfer by DRDO. In his inaugural address, the DRDO Chairman described DTTC as a brainchild of Raksha Mantri, Shri Rajnath Singh, which is today bearing fruits for the benefit of the industries. He informed the MSMEs about the various technologies & industry centric policies for the MSMEs and said that it is the opportune time for MSMEs to engage in Defense R&D.
He assured that DRDO will provide all possible support to MSMEs to make the nation Aatmanirbhar Bharat leading to Viksit Bharat by 2047. Raksha Mantri has complimented DRDO and the MSMEs for organizing the conclave and appreciated the important role played by MSMEs to realize Prime Minister, Shri Narendra Modi’s vision of Aatmanirbhar Bharat. The dignitaries who attended the event include DG (Naval Systems & Materials), Dr R V Hara Prasad; DG (Technology Management), Dr L C Mangal and DG (Human Resources), Dr Mayank Dwivedi.
